Education
1966-1972 Ph.D. (CSc.) in organic chemistry, under Dr. K.Bláha at Department of Natural Products, Institute of Organic Chemistry and Biochemistry, Czechoslovak Academy of Sciences, Prague.
1961-1968 M.Sc. (RNDr.) in organic chemistry, under Prof. A. Vystrčil at Department of OrganicChemistry, Faculty of Natural Sciences, Charles University, Prague.
 
Experience
1990-1991 Research fellow with Prof. F.A.M. Borremans, Biomolecular NMR Unit, University Gent, Belgium.
1978-1979 Postdoctoral fellow with Prof. M.J.O.Anteunis, State University in Gent, Belgium.
 
Appointments
since 2007 Head of NMR Research-Service Team, Institute of Organic Chemistry and Biochemistry v.v.i., AS CR, Prague.
2003-2006 Head of Department of Organic Structure analysis, Institute of Organic Chemistry, and Biochemistry, AS CR, Prague.
1981-1991 Head of Central NMR laboratory of chemical institutes of AS CR, Prague.
since 1981 Head of Department of NMR Spectroscopy, Institute of Organic Chemistry and Biochemistry, AS CR, Prague.
1972-1981 Research scientist and senior scientist, Department of NMR Spectroscopy, Institute of Organic Chemistry, and Biochemistry, AS CR, Prague.
 
Awards
1986 National prize of the Czechoslovak Academy of Sciences.
1987 Joint prize of Polish and Czechoslovak Academy of Sciences.
 
Membership
Czech Chemical Society; Ioannes Marcus Marci Spectroscopic Society.
 
Research interest
NMR spectroscopy, structure and conformational analysis of organic compounds (peptides and proteins, nucleotides, saccharides, terpenoids, alkaloids), molecular modeling, theoretical calculations of NMR parameters.
